Nigel was kind enough to send us a photo from across the pond of his weekly shopping setup. Its a great use of the Carry Freedom Y-frame bike trailer and stack-able plastic containers. Nigel claims that he can use this trailer along with a set of rear panniers to shop for a family of four for the week.

Nigel estimated that by the time he arrived at the store, found a place to park his car, walking to and from the car, and packing and unpacking the “boot”, the bike was actually faster even with an uphill back to the house. The Carry Freedom Y-frame is a great trailer, unfortunately it is currently unavailable in the U.S., but there is a alternative option that might even be better. Check out the Wandertec BONGO, it is similar to the Y-frame with a flat universal load bed and an open platform design, but the BONGO uses a round hitch arm allowing the load bed surface to be level regardless of how high or low the hitch is, a draw back of the Carry Freedom Y-frame.
